Blockchain-based product authentication system

This invention describes a system where a device, like a smartphone, interacts with a product to scan a unique code. This code links to a blockchain record that verifies the product's authenticity and can display additional content, such as promotional material from the manufacturer. Notably, the system allows for new content to be added to the product's blockchain record even after the product has been sold to a consumer.

Why it matters: Filed before the significant maturation of enterprise-grade blockchain platforms and developer tooling, which now make building and integrating such a system more accessible. The claims' focus on dynamic, post-sale content delivery via blockchain also aligns with the growing industry interest in Web3 and digital twin applications for physical products.
